Abstract:
User authentication is most essential to prevent the unauthorized adversaries from obtaining the system resources. This paper proposes a cellular automata based remote-user authentication (CARA) scheme to reduce the complexity of encryption and hash-based cryptosystems. CARA uses cache-based nonce to avoid synchronization problems and thwart replay attacks. This scheme is robust against other attacks as well. The inherent parallelism of cellular automata provides for its fast implementation
